What Is Crack Cocaine?
Crack cocaine is a smokable form of cocaine made by processing powdered cocaine with baking soda or a similar substance and water, then heating it until it forms solid crystals or “rocks.” When heated and smoked, it produces a cracking sound, which is where the name “crack” comes from.

Unlike powdered cocaine, which is usually snorted, crack cocaine is absorbed rapidly through the lungs. This results in an almost immediate and intense effect, making it far more addictive than many other forms of cocaine.

How Crack Cocaine Affects the Brain and Body
Crack cocaine is a powerful stimulant that strongly affects the central nervous system. Once inhaled, it reaches the brain within seconds, causing a rapid surge of dopamine, the chemical associated with pleasure and reward.

Common short-term effects include:
- Intense euphoria
- Increased energy and alertness
- Reduced appetite
- Increased heart rate and blood pressure
- Dilated pupils
The “high” from crack cocaine is very intense but short-lived, often lasting only a few minutes. This rapid rise and fall encourages repeated use, increasing the risk of addiction.

Psychological Effects
Crack cocaine has profound psychological effects. While initial use may cause feelings of confidence and excitement, these effects often quickly turn negative.

Psychological effects may include:
- Anxiety and restlessness
- Paranoia and suspicious thinking
- Aggression and irritability
- Panic attacks
- Hallucinations and psychosis
With repeated use, individuals may experience severe mental health problems, including long-lasting paranoia and mood disorders.

Physical Health Risks
Crack cocaine places extreme stress on the body, particularly the heart, lungs, and brain.

Cardiovascular Risks
Crack cocaine significantly increases the risk of heart attack, irregular heartbeat, and stroke. These events can occur even in young, otherwise healthy individuals and may happen after a single use.

Respiratory Damage
Smoking crack cocaine damages the lungs and airways. Chronic use can cause coughing, chest pain, breathing difficulties, and a condition often referred to as “crack lung,” which involves inflammation and bleeding in the lungs.

Neurological Damage
Repeated use can lead to seizures, headaches, and long-term brain changes that affect memory, attention, and decision-making.

Addiction and Dependence
Crack cocaine is highly addictive. Because the effects are intense and short-lived, users often feel a strong urge to take more almost immediately. This pattern can quickly lead to binge use and dependence.
Addiction to crack cocaine is characterized by:
- Loss of control over use
- Strong cravings
- Continued use despite harm
- Neglect of responsibilities and relationships
Withdrawal symptoms may include depression, fatigue, irritability, sleep problems, and intense cravings, making it difficult to stop without support.
Long-Term Consequences
Long-term crack cocaine use can have devastating effects on a person’s life and health. These may include:
- Chronic heart and lung disease
- Severe mental health disorders
- Weight loss and malnutrition
- Increased risk of infectious diseases
- Social isolation and financial problems
The impact often extends beyond the individual, affecting families, communities, and public health systems.
Legal Status of Crack Cocaine
Crack cocaine is illegal in almost every country. It is classified as a controlled substance with no accepted recreational use and severe penalties for possession, production, or distribution.
In many legal systems, crack cocaine is treated as harshly as or even more harshly than powdered cocaine. Penalties can include:
- Heavy fines
- Long prison sentences
- Permanent criminal records
Laws often impose stricter punishment for trafficking or distribution, especially in cases involving large quantities.
Social and Legal Consequences
Beyond legal penalties, a conviction related to crack cocaine can have lasting social consequences. These may include difficulty finding employment, restrictions on travel, loss of housing opportunities, and strained personal relationships.
Criminal records related to drug offenses often follow individuals for life, limiting future opportunities even after sentences are served.
Myths and Misconceptions
A common misconception is that crack cocaine is simply a cheaper or weaker version of powdered cocaine. In reality, crack cocaine is more potent and more addictive due to how quickly it reaches the brain.
Another myth is that smoking crack is safer than injecting drugs. While injection carries its own risks, smoking crack cocaine causes severe harm to the lungs and heart and does not reduce the danger of overdose or addiction.
Public Health Perspective
From a public health standpoint, crack cocaine is viewed as a high-risk substance with significant potential for harm. Efforts to address crack cocaine use focus on prevention, education, treatment, and harm reduction rather than punishment alone.
Medical professionals emphasize that addiction is a health condition and that effective treatment often requires long-term support, counseling, and sometimes medical intervention.
